What You Will Do
To provide support to the Surgical Services Department by maintaining departmental and interdepartmental communications creating an efficient functioning Surgical Services Arena.
Preferred Qualifications
- H.S. Diploma or Equivalent
- 1 Year Experience within a hospital and/or medical setting
Essential Functions
- Customer service
Consistently communicates in a positive manner with staff members, all employees, physicians, physicians office personnel, and other departments.
- Surgical procedures scheduling
Consistently schedules emergency / add-on surgical procedures accurately and completely (departmental and interdepartmental), demonstrating good time management and priority setting capability.
Consistently completes all components of the scheduling procedure: prepare copies of schedules and/or added procedures and route copies to appropriate areas; print schedules for next shift, informs appropriate leadership, staff and/or materials management of case requests; notifies other departments as indicatedConsistently monitors surgery schedule to assure maximum efficient use of surgical room time, staff and equipment. When possible, schedules same doctor in same room to minimize O.R. delays. Notifies O.R. Aides for efficient room turn-over, to transport patients to the O.R., and as needed in the O.R. Suites.
Notifies PACU regarding completion of surgical procedures. Alerts other departments regarding patient preparation, i.e. procedural time changes, transport readiness, old charts, etc.
Identifies department needs and takes appropriate action, without prompting, to accomplish department objectives and improve quality of care.
Assists co-workers as needed.
